MacCallum CA, Lo LA, Boivin M. Clinical Application of Cannabis Vaporization: Examining Safety and Best Practices. Cannabis Cannabinoid Res 2024. [PMID: 38394323 DOI: 10.1089/can.2023.0219]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/25/2024] Open
Abstract
Introduction: Cannabis vaporization is useful for individuals requiring fast-acting method of cannabis administration and for individuals using smoked cannabis as a harm reduction tool. There is a need for guidance on how to assess if a patient is a vaporization candidate and how to safely initiate and monitor cannabis vaporization. Methods: An overview of safe cannabis vaporization, including practical guidance and tactics to promote the lowest-risk use, is provided. This review was developed through a combination of expert clinical opinion and reviewing the available literature. Results: Dried cannabis vaporizers and metered-dose inhalers are recommended to be used over other vaporization devices. Assessing the benefit versus risks of vaporized cannabis and providing guidance for choosing a vaporization device, choosing a cannabis chemovar, and employing a mindful vaping technique are important steps in the safe utilization of vaporized cannabis. Dosing optimization and monitoring to limit adverse events and improve symptom control are essential. Discussion: The utilization of cannabis vaporization presents an important opportunity for clinicians and other health professionals to help facilitate safer cannabis administration and reduce the prevalence of smoked cannabis.

Clendennen SL, Rangwala S, Sumbe A, Case KR, Wilkinson AV, Loukas A, Harrell MB. Understanding college students' experiences using e-cigarettes and marijuana through qualitative interviews. JOURNAL OF AMERICAN COLLEGE HEALTH : J OF ACH 2023; 71:2848-2858. [PMID: 34871132 PMCID: PMC9178769 DOI: 10.1080/07448481.2021.1998073] [Citation(s) in RCA: 3]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Subscribe] [Scholar Register] [Received: 03/05/2021] [Revised: 08/28/2021] [Accepted: 10/17/2021] [Indexed: 06/08/2023]
Abstract
OBJECTIVE To investigate the contexts in which college students use e-cigarettes and marijuana, perceptions about the benefits and harms, and health effects of use. PARTICIPANTS College student e-cigarette and marijuana ever users (n = 20; 18-21 years old) from the Texas Adolescent Tobacco and Marketing Surveillance System (TATAMS). METHODS Participants completed a one-hour long online interview about their experiences using e-cigarettes and marijuana. Thematic content analysis in NVivo identified prominent themes. RESULTS Vaping nicotine and marijuana were preferred and perceived as normal, trendy and useful in circumventing smoke-free campus policies. Preference for nicotine versus marijuana fluctuates during the academic school year in response to campus restrictions and work and school-related activities. College students commonly experienced health effects (shortness of breath, wheezing) attributed to vaping, did not perceive their use as very harmful, and perceived their use as a college-related phase. CONCLUSIONS Findings have implications for college-based health education, resources, and smoke-free policies.

Waddell JT, Merrill JE, Okey SA, Woods-Gonzalez R, Corbin WR. Subjective effects of simultaneous alcohol and cannabis versus alcohol-only use: A qualitative analysis. PSYCHOLOGY OF ADDICTIVE BEHAVIORS 2023; 37:906-917. [PMID: 36757980 PMCID: PMC10409872 DOI: 10.1037/adb0000908]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/10/2023]
Abstract
OBJECTIVE Theoretical models of addictive behavior suggest that subjective effects serve as a mechanism through which substance use disorders develop. However, little is known about the subjective effects of simultaneous alcohol and cannabis use, particularly whether simultaneous use (a) heightens specific subjective effects or (b) is related to unique subjective effects relative to single-substance effects. The present study used formative, qualitative data analysis to examine patterns of responses within open-answer text response data on subjective effects of simultaneous use. METHOD College students who simultaneously use alcohol and cannabis (N = 443; 68.2% female) were asked to describe how alcohol effects differ on simultaneous alcohol and cannabis use versus alcohol-only use days. RESULTS Conventional content analysis revealed nine concepts related to simultaneous (vs. alcohol-only) use subjective effects including as follows: (a) increased/decreased impairment, (b) low arousal/relaxation, (c) balancing/replacement effects, (d) "cross-faded" effects, (e) little-to-no differences, (f) altered sensation and perception, (g) increased negative affective states, (h) increased appetite, and (i) increased/decreased negative consequences. Increased impairment (N = 191) and increased relaxation (N = 110) were the most often endorsed subjective effects, followed by decreased impairment (N = 55), balancing/replacement effects (N = 50) and cross-faded/enhancement effects (N = 44). CONCLUSIONS Subjective effects from simultaneous use largely map onto domains of single-substance alcohol and cannabis effects (e.g., relaxation, sociability, cognitive/behavioral impairment), but also include distinct domains related to simultaneous use (e.g., balancing/replacement effects, altered sensation and perception). Future quantitative research is needed to validate measures of subjective effects from simultaneous use and their relations with use behavior. Marinello S. Social Media Marketing Practices of Illinois Recreational Cannabis Dispensaries in the First Year of Legal Sales: Product Promotions, Branding, and Price Promotions. JOURNAL OF DRUG ISSUES 2023. [DOI: 10.1177/00220426231159542]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/27/2023]
Abstract
Research from tobacco suggests that the recreational cannabis industry will use aggressive tactics, including product innovation and mass-marketing and advertising, to increase demand for their products. The purpose of this study is to examine product promotions, branding, and promotional pricing on recreational dispensary social media pages in the state of Illinois in the first year of legal sales. Data were collected from all recreational cannabis dispensary Facebook and Twitter accounts and a quantitative content analysis was used to analyze the data. Differences in marketing practices were assessed by neighborhood race/ethnicity and income and dispensary type. Results of the study revealed that flower and edibles were the two most heavily promoted products; promotions for vaporizers and concentrates were also promoted frequently. Posts with branded promotions and price promotions increased substantially over the year. Research suggests that this trend in marketing practices will lead to greater initiation and intensity of cannabis use.

Berey BL, Aston ER, Gebru NM, Merrill JE. Differences in cannabis use characteristics, routines, and reasons for use among individuals with and without a medical cannabis card. Exp Clin Psychopharmacol 2023; 31:14-22. [PMID: 35025588 PMCID: PMC9276841 DOI: 10.1037/pha0000542] [Citation(s) in RCA: 2]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 01/26/2023]
Abstract
As recreational and medical cannabis use increases in the U.S., the proliferation of novel cannabis products is expected to continue. Understanding cannabis product preferences and use patterns may inform public health and policy decisions. This study investigated similarities and differences in cannabis use patterns, product preferences, and beliefs about cannabis' subjective effects and therapeutic benefits among individuals with and without a medical cannabis card (MCC). Participants with an MCC completed individual interviews (N = 25; 40% male). Participants without an MCC completed focus groups (N = 31; 6-7 participants/group; 72% male). All sessions followed a semistructured agenda. Participants were queried about their use routines, reasons for using cannabis, and perceptions and experiences of subjective cannabis effects. Thematic analysis of coded transcripts revealed that MCC participants had structured, daily cannabis use routines whereas non-MCC participants' use routines were less structured. Product information including strain and cannabinoid composition were important to MCC participants whereas non-MCC participants primarily evaluated quality based on perceptual (e.g., olfactory) cues. Regardless of MCC status, participants reported misconceptions about cannabis' therapeutic benefits and agreed that the two primary cannabis strains-Indica and Sativa-produced primarily sedative and stimulant effects, respectively. Results have clinical, public health, and policy implications surrounding cannabis recommendation guidelines and ways providers can relay accurate information to patients seeking medical cannabis. Future research assessing demographic and geographic differences in cannabis product preferences and beliefs about medical cannabis use is warranted. Further, quantitative research is needed to evaluate whether cannabis' therapeutic value differs across products. (PsycInfo Database Record (c) 2023 APA, all rights reserved).

McKenzie N, Glassman TJ, Dake JA, Maloney SM, Na L. Factors that influence cannabis vaping habits of college students: A qualitative study. JOURNAL OF AMERICAN COLLEGE HEALTH : J OF ACH 2022:1-8. [PMID: 36282209 DOI: 10.1080/07448481.2022.2135375]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Subscribe] [Scholar Register] [Received: 05/13/2021] [Revised: 08/30/2022] [Accepted: 10/07/2022] [Indexed: 06/16/2023]
Abstract
Objective: The purpose of this study is to examine the attitudes and perceptions of college undergraduates regarding cannabis vaping. Participants: Twenty-one, predominantly male (71.4%; Mage = 22, SD = 2.09), undergraduate college students who reported vaping cannabis in the past 30 days. Methods: Participants were interviewed to determine their attitudes and perceptions regarding cannabis vaping. Findings: Thematic analysis uncovered six primary themes and eighteen subthemes. Main themes included (1) Convenience, (2) Discreetness, (3) Mood-Altering Experience, (4) Social Acceptability, (5) Health and Safety, and (6) COVID-19 Pandemic Impact. Conclusion: College students who use cannabis tend to both vape and use combustible methods, depending upon social and physical environment. This population tends to vaporize cannabis for its perceived mood-altering properties. Additional research is needed to further examine the behaviors and attitudes surrounding cannabis vaping among college undergraduates, as well as the development of interventions specific to this demographic.

Watson CV, Alexander DS, Oliver BE, Trivers KF. Substance use among adult marijuana and nicotine e-cigarette or vaping product users, 2020. Addict Behav 2022; 132:107349. [PMID: 35580371 PMCID: PMC11056937 DOI: 10.1016/j.addbeh.2022.107349]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/08/2021] [Revised: 04/28/2022] [Accepted: 04/30/2022] [Indexed: 11/01/2022]
Abstract
INTRODUCTION Co-use of marijuana and tobacco/nicotine have unknown impacts on addiction and health. There are limited data on the extent to which adults are co-using tetrahydrocannabinol (THC)- and nicotine-containing products, in any of their various modes. This study describes adult use of THC- and nicotine-containing products among electronic vaping product (EVP) users. METHODS Data on marijuana and tobacco use were collected from February 25-29, 2020 through an online survey of adults aged ≥18 years who reported using THC- and nicotine-containing electronic vaping products (EVPs) in the past 3 months (n = 3,980). Survey respondents from 18 states participated in the U.S. YouGov panel, a proprietary opt-in internet panel survey of 1.8 million U.S. residents. RESULTS Among those who reported using nicotine and THC-containing EVPs in the past 3 months, 90.1% of respondents reported smoking marijuana in the past 3 months; 82.7% reported smoking as the most frequent mode of marijuana use. Almost 63% of EVP users reported smoking cigarettes; 55.6% reported smoking for over 8 years, while 7.7% had been smoking cigarettes for under a year. CONCLUSIONS In this study, respondents reported cigarette smoking and marijuana smoking in addition to using marijuana- and nicotine- containing EVPs. Considering the unknown health effects of co-use of tobacco and THC-containing products, the finding that adults are vaping THC and nicotine alongside traditional modes of marijuana and tobacco use of these substances warrants further investigation. IMPLICATIONS Findings from this study provide evidence that adults who use nicotine and THC EVPs are also using a variety of other THC-containing and tobacco-containing products. This indicates the importance of continued surveillance to assess trends of polysubstance EVP and multi-modal marijuana and tobacco use. Monitoring various modes of marijuana and tobacco use may inform policies, prevention education, communication, and cessation tools.

Abstract
Purpose of Review To explore relations between behavioral economic demand for cannabis and cannabis use disorder (CUD). Prior reviews have focused on drug demand in relation to use outcomes more generally. Complementing and enhancing prior work synthesizing research on cannabis demand, the present review endeavors to determine whether specific demand indices derived from the marijuana purchase task are most reliably related to CUD. Additionally, sociodemographic characteristics of participants in these studies were reviewed to identify whether certain populations were underrepresented in behavioral economic cannabis research. Recent Findings Behavioral economic demand is related to CUD; intensity and elasticity of cannabis demand were consistently associated with CUD diagnosis and severity. However, frequently, only select demand indices were assessed or reported, precluding the ability to confirm which indices are superior for denoting CUD risk. Further, most studies enrolled samples that were predominately young adults, Caucasian, and male. Summary As CUD becomes more prevalent in the wake of cannabis legalization, identification of robust predictors of CUD risk is paramount. Cannabis demand is consistently associated with CUD; however, individual indices of import in this relationship remain ambiguous. Subsequent research is needed to confirm index-specific markers of disordered cannabis use, and whether links between demand and CUD generalize across diverse populations.

Cloutier RM, Calhoun BH, Linden-Carmichael AN. Associations of mode of administration on cannabis consumption and subjective intoxication in daily life. PSYCHOLOGY OF ADDICTIVE BEHAVIORS 2022; 36:67-77. [PMID: 34472879 PMCID: PMC8831393 DOI: 10.1037/adb0000726] [Citation(s) in RCA: 10] [Impact Index Per Article: 5.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/03/2023]
Abstract
OBJECTIVE As cannabis products are becoming increasingly available and young adults are increasingly using vaporizers to consume cannabis, there is a need to understand how this population is using different modes of administration and the extent to which specific modes are associated with differential cannabis use outcomes. Toward this end, the current study characterized predictors of cannabis mode of administration and examined how consumption levels and subjective intoxication vary as a function of mode of administration in daily life. METHOD Participants were 106 young adult cannabis and heavy alcohol users (51% female) who completed up to 14 daily diaries (n = 1,405 person days). Each day, participants reported whether they used any cannabis and, if any, which mode(s) were used, number of hits used per mode, overall subjective intoxication, and the socio-environmental context in which they used cannabis. RESULTS Across all cannabis use days, Bong-Only and Vape-Only days were the most common, followed by Multimode, Joint-, Pipe-, and Blunt-Only days. Participants reporting a greater proportion of cannabis use days were more likely to report Bong-Only and Multimode days than Vape-Only days. Compared to Vape-Only days, participants reported fewer hits on Bong-Only days and more hits on Blunt-Only, Pipe-Only, and Multimode days. Participants felt more intoxicated on Bong-Only days than Vape-Only days. CONCLUSIONS Mode-specific associations with cannabis consumption and subjective intoxication levels suggest assessing modes of administration may be a meaningful way to guide individual and public health intervention efforts. Fischer B, Robinson T, Bullen C, Curran V, Jutras-Aswad D, Medina-Mora ME, Pacula RL, Rehm J, Room R, van den Brink W, Hall W. Lower-Risk Cannabis Use Guidelines (LRCUG) for reducing health harms from non-medical cannabis use: A comprehensive evidence and recommendations update. THE INTERNATIONAL JOURNAL OF DRUG POLICY 2022; 99:103381. [PMID: 34465496 DOI: 10.1016/j.drugpo.2021.103381] [Citation(s) in RCA: 55] [Impact Index Per Article: 27.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/29/2021] [Revised: 07/05/2021] [Accepted: 07/07/2021] [Indexed: 02/08/2023]
Abstract
BACKGROUND Cannabis use is common, especially among young people, and is associated with risks for various health harms. Some jurisdictions have recently moved to legalization/regulation pursuing public health goals. Evidence-based 'Lower Risk Cannabis Use Guidelines' (LRCUG) and recommendations were previously developed to reduce modifiable risk factors of cannabis-related adverse health outcomes; related evidence has evolved substantially since. We aimed to review new scientific evidence and to develop comprehensively up-to-date LRCUG, including their recommendations, on this evidence basis. METHODS Targeted searches for literature (since 2016) on main risk factors for cannabis-related adverse health outcomes modifiable by the user-individual were conducted. Topical areas were informed by previous LRCUG content and expanded upon current evidence. Searches preferentially focused on systematic reviews, supplemented by key individual studies. The review results were evidence-graded, topically organized and narratively summarized; recommendations were developed through an iterative scientific expert consensus development process. RESULTS A substantial body of modifiable risk factors for cannabis use-related health harms were identified with varying evidence quality. Twelve substantive recommendation clusters and three precautionary statements were developed. In general, current evidence suggests that individuals can substantially reduce their risk for adverse health outcomes if they delay the onset of cannabis use until after adolescence, avoid the use of high-potency (THC) cannabis products and high-frequency/-intensity of use, and refrain from smoking-routes for administration. While young people are particularly vulnerable to cannabis-related harms, other sub-groups (e.g., pregnant women, drivers, older adults, those with co-morbidities) are advised to exercise particular caution with use-related risks. Legal/regulated cannabis products should be used where possible. CONCLUSIONS Cannabis use can result in adverse health outcomes, mostly among sub-groups with higher-risk use. Reducing the risk factors identified can help to reduce health harms from use. The LRCUG offer one targeted intervention component within a comprehensive public health approach for cannabis use. They require effective audience-tailoring and dissemination, regular updating as new evidence become available, and should be evaluated for their impact.

Cloutier RM, Calhoun BH, Lanza ST, Linden-Carmichael AN. Assessing subjective cannabis effects in daily life with contemporary young adult language. Drug Alcohol Depend 2022; 230:109205. [PMID: 34890928 PMCID: PMC8714699 DOI: 10.1016/j.drugalcdep.2021.109205]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 09/03/2021] [Revised: 11/02/2021] [Accepted: 11/06/2021] [Indexed: 01/03/2023]
Abstract
INTRODUCTION Subjective ratings of cannabis effects are important predictors of use-related consequences. However, psychometric research is fairly limited, particularly for measures to capture variability in daily life when diverse modes of cannabis administration and co-substance use are common. METHODS This study evaluated the predictive utility of a revised item to assess perceived cannabis effects and examined modes of cannabis administration and alcohol and nicotine co-use as moderators. Participants were 106 young adults (18-25 years; 51% female) who completed up to 14 consecutive daily reports of substance use (n = 1405 person-days). Two measures of subjective effects were examined: a standard item (0-100 rating of "how high do you feel?") and a revised item that uses four crowd-sourced anchor points ranging from relaxed (0), calm/chill (33), high (67), and stoned/baked (100). The items shared substantial variance (Pseudo-R2 = 59.5%), however, the revised item showed greater within-person variability (77.0% vs. 68.8%) and stronger day-level associations with consumption levels (Pseudo-R2 = 25.0% vs. 16.7%). RESULTS The cannabis consumption-subjective effects link was weaker on blunt-only days compared to vape-only days. Subjective cannabis effects were higher on nicotine co-use days after controlling for cannabis consumption; neither alcohol nor nicotine co-use moderated the cannabis consumption-subjective effects link. DISCUSSION The revised subjective cannabis effects item is a viable alternative to the standard item among young adults who engage in simultaneous alcohol and cannabis use. CONCLUSIONS Future research focused on characterizing the variability in cannabis effects is needed.

Tetrahydrocannabinol (THC)-containing e-cigarette, or vaping, product use behaviors among adults after the onset of the 2019 outbreak of e-cigarette, or vaping, product use-associated lung injury (EVALI). Addict Behav 2021; 121:106990. [PMID: 34087764 DOI: 10.1016/j.addbeh.2021.106990] [Citation(s) in RCA: 4]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/02/2021] [Revised: 05/09/2021] [Accepted: 05/12/2021] [Indexed: 01/20/2023]
Abstract
INTRODUCTION During the E-cigarette, or Vaping, Product Use-Associated Lung Injury (EVALI) outbreak, patient data on tetrahydrocannabinol (THC)-containing e-cigarette, or vaping, product (EVP) use was collected, but data on non-affected adult product use after the onset of the EVALI outbreak is limited. This study describes adult THC-EVP use after EVALI began. METHODS THC-EVP use data came from an 18-state web-based panel survey of adult THC- and nicotine-containing EVP users conducted February 2020. Unweighted descriptive statistics were calculated; logistic regression assessed correlates of use. RESULTS Among 3,980 THC-EVP users, 23.5% used THC-EVPs daily. Common brands of THC-EVPs used were Dank Vapes (47.7%) and Golden Gorilla (38.7%). Reported substances used included THC oils (69.6%), marijuana herb (63.6%) and THC concentrate (46.4%). Access sources included: recreational dispensaries (41.1%), friend/family member (38.6%) and illicit dealers (15.1%). Respondents aged 45-64 years had lower odds for daily use compared with those aged 25-34 years (aOR = 0.73; 95% CI = 0.60, 0.90). Compared with White respondents, Asian respondents had lower odds (aOR = 0.55; 95% CI = 0.36, 0.84) and Black respondents higher odds (aOR = 1.48; 95% CI = 1.17, 1.86) of daily use. Respondents odds of daily use and accessing THC-EVPs through commercial sources were higher among states with legalized nonmedical adult marijuana use compared to states without. CONCLUSIONS Almost half of respondents reported daily or weekly THC-EVP use, and accessed products through both informal and formal sources, even after EVALI began. Given the potential for future EVALI-like conditions to occur, it is important to monitor the use of THC-EVPs and ensure effective education activities about associated risk.

Smith DM, Kozlowski L, O'Connor RJ, Hyland A, Collins RL. Reasons for individual and concurrent use of vaped nicotine and cannabis: their similarities, differences, and association with product use. J Cannabis Res 2021; 3:39. [PMID: 34452640 PMCID: PMC8401016 DOI: 10.1186/s42238-021-00097-7] [Citation(s) in RCA: 9]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/08/2021] [Accepted: 08/15/2021] [Indexed: 11/10/2022] Open
Abstract
BACKGROUND Understanding similarities, differences, and associations between reasons people vape nicotine and cannabis may be important for identifying underlying contributors to their co-use. METHODS A cross-sectional survey of 112 co-users of vaped nicotine and cannabis was conducted in 2020. A convenience sample of participants was recruited for the survey using Amazon Mechanical Turk. Participants responded to questions about their reasons for individual nicotine and cannabis product use and co-use and rated their level of agreement using numerical scales. Mean ratings for each reason for use subscale were examined across all participants and compared using paired samples t tests. Associations between reasons for use ratings and product consumption behaviors were examined using linear and logistic regression analyses. RESULTS Cannabis vaping and smoking exhibited similar mean ratings for user experience and product/substance-related reasons for use. Mean ratings for reasons related to product utility were similar for cannabis vaping and nicotine vaping. Mean ratings for utility-related reasons for use were higher for cannabis vaping than cannabis smoking (mean (SD), 3.6 (± 1.0) vs. 2.6 (± 1.2), p < 0.0001). On average, harm reduction-related reasons for use were rated higher for nicotine vaping than cannabis vaping (2.4 (± 1.6) vs. 1.8 (± 1.4), p < 0.0001). Regression models showed higher average ratings for utility-related (b = 0.32; 95% CI, 0.03-0.60) and harm reduction-related (b = 0.21; 95% CI, 0.04-0.37) reasons for nicotine vaping were associated with more frequent nicotine vaping (both p < 0.05). Higher average ratings for instrumentality-related reasons for co-use corresponded with more frequent monthly nicotine vaping (b = 0.26; 95% CI, 0.08-0.44) and higher odds of ever chasing cannabis with nicotine (aOR, 3.06; 95% CI, 1.29-7.30). CONCLUSIONS Vaping serves purposes that differ by substance; nicotine vaping was more closely related to reducing tobacco smoking-related harms, and cannabis vaping was more closely related to circumventing social problems posed by cannabis smoking. Lifetime sequential co-use practices and more frequent nicotine vaping were associated with enhancing the intoxicating effects of cannabis. While replication of these findings using non convenience-based sampling approaches is warranted, results underscore the need to consider shared and unique aspects of nicotine and cannabis vaping, as well as cross-substance interactions between nicotine and cannabis.

Shi Y. Heterogeneities in administration methods among cannabis users by use purpose and state legalization status: findings from a nationally representative survey in the United States, 2020. Addiction 2021; 116:1782-1793. [PMID: 33217090 PMCID: PMC8134617 DOI: 10.1111/add.15342]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/05/2020] [Revised: 08/04/2020] [Accepted: 11/17/2020] [Indexed: 12/11/2022]
Abstract
BACKGROUND AND AIMS Different cannabis administration methods have differential impacts on health. This study aimed to describe administration methods among cannabis users in the United States categorized by (1) use purpose and (2) state legalization status. DESIGN Cross-sectional, probability-based online survey in 2020. SETTING All 50 states and Washington DC in the United States. PARTICIPANTS A total of 21 903 adults (18+) were recruited from a probability-based online panel to provide nationally representative estimates. METHODS Eleven administration methods were grouped into combustion, vaporization, ingestion and topicals. Weighted prevalence was reported among (1) medical-only, recreational-only and dual-purpose users based on self-reported purposes and (2) users in states that legalized both recreational and medical cannabis (RCL states), legalized medical cannabis only and did not legalize cannabis. FINDINGS Among past-year users, the proportions of medical-only, recreational-only and dual-purpose users were 25.55, 43.81 and 30.64%, respectively. The most common primary methods were combustion (42.08%) and topicals (28.65%) for medical purposes and combustion (72.07%) and ingestion (15.05%) for recreational purposes. Dual-purpose users were more likely to report combustion and vaporization but less likely to report ingestion and topicals as primary methods for medical use than medical-only users (P < 0.001) and more likely to report combustion and topicals but less likely to report ingestion as primary methods for recreational use than recreational-only users (P < 0.041). A higher proportion of dual-purpose users (82.82%) used more than one method than medical-only (40.52%) and recreational-only users (63.91%) (P < 0.001). For both medical and recreational purposes, RCL states had the lowest rate of combustion and the highest rates of ingestion and topicals reported as primary methods (P < 0.033). The rate of using more than one administration method did not differ across states (P > 0.05). CONCLUSION Cannabis users whose purposes are medical, recreational or both tend to differ in their selected administration methods.

Spillane TE, Wong BA, Giovenco DP. Content analysis of instagram posts by leading cannabis vaporizer brands. Drug Alcohol Depend 2021; 218:108353. [PMID: 33109462 PMCID: PMC7750198 DOI: 10.1016/j.drugalcdep.2020.108353] [Citation(s) in RCA: 10] [Impact Index Per Article: 3.3]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/11/2020] [Revised: 10/02/2020] [Accepted: 10/06/2020] [Indexed: 11/21/2022]
Abstract
BACKGROUND Cannabis vaporizer companies leverage social media to market their products, but little is known about the content of the messages being delivered to consumers. This study describes characteristics of Instagram posts from three popular cannabis vaporizer brands in the U.S. METHODS A content analysis was performed on posts uploaded between October 2017 and October 2018 by the brands Kandypens (n = 731), G Pen (n = 454), and Pax (n = 71). Posts were coded for: characteristics of individuals pictured, health and risk statements, references to cannabis, co-marketing activities, cartoon images, and product price. Descriptive statistics highlight the prevalence of these characteristics and between-brand differences. RESULTS Posts had a wide reach, with a total of 467,700 followers across brands. Two-thirds (68.0 %) of posts depicted someone using the product. Among posts featuring a person, (83.9 %) depicted female users. Overall, cannabis was rarely mentioned (8.9 %) or depicted (10.0 %) in posts. "Tagging" social media influencers (34.3 % of posts) and other companies or their products (31.9 % of posts) were popular promotional strategies. Few posts mentioned age restrictions (0.3 %), health risks (5.2 %), or health benefits (0.2 %). CONCLUSIONS Cannabis vaporizer companies reach thousands of consumers through brand-owned social media accounts. Strategies to promote their products on these channels include posts that may appeal to sociodemographic groups and leveraging social media influencers and other companies to increase overall reach. As legalized recreational cannabis expands and a range of consumption methods become popular, an understanding of brands' social media marketing practices is needed to inform policies and interventions that promote population health.

Gunn RL, Aston ER, Sokolovsky AW, White HR, Jackson KM. Complex cannabis use patterns: Associations with cannabis consequences and cannabis use disorder symptomatology. Addict Behav 2020; 105:106329. [PMID: 32044680 DOI: 10.1016/j.addbeh.2020.106329] [Citation(s) in RCA: 30] [Impact Index Per Article: 7.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/09/2019] [Revised: 01/23/2020] [Accepted: 01/26/2020] [Indexed: 12/30/2022]
Abstract
BACKGROUND Historically, cannabis researchers have assumed a single mode and product of cannabis (e.g., smoking plant). However, patterns of use, products (e.g., concentrates, edibles), and modes (e.g. blunts, vaporizers) are diversifying. This study sought to: 1) classify cannabis users into groups based on their use of the full range of cannabis products, and 2) examine user group differences on demographics, cannabis consequences and cannabis use disorder (CUD) symptomatology. METHODS In a sample of college students (data collected in Fall 2017), who used cannabis in the past year (N = 1390), latent class analysis (LCA) was used to characterize cannabis users. We then added demographic characteristics, cannabis consequences, and CUD symptomatology scores separately to LCA models to examine class differences. RESULTS Five unique classes emerged: high-frequency all-product users, high-frequency plant/moderate-frequency edible and concentrate users, low-frequency plant users, moderate-frequency plant and edible users, and low-frequency edible users. Demographic characteristics, cannabis consequences, and CUD symptomatology differed across classes characterized by frequency as well as product. CONCLUSIONS Results reflect the increasing variety of cannabis products, modes, and use patterns among college students. In this sample, frequency of use remains a strong predictor of cannabis-related consequences, in addition to type of product. As variation in cannabis use patterns continue to evolve, it is essential for researchers to conduct comprehensive assessments.

Kastaun S, Hildebrandt J, Kotz D. Electronic Cigarettes to Vaporize Cannabis: Prevalence of Use and Associated Factors among Current Electronic Cigarette Users in Germany (DEBRA Study). Subst Use Misuse 2020; 55:1106-1112. [PMID: 32091941 DOI: 10.1080/10826084.2020.1729197] [Citation(s) in RCA: 4]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 10/24/2022]
Abstract
Background: In Germany, cannabis is the most widely used illicit drug, and inhalation together with tobacco is most popular. However, it has been described that electronic cigarettes (ECs) are being used to vaporize cannabis (extract). No current data on EC cannabis use in the German population are yet available. Objectives: This study examines the prevalence of EC cannabis consumption for mood changing effects among current EC users, and associated consumer characteristics in Germany. Methods: We used data from the German Study on Tobacco Use (period: 8/2016-01/2019, DEBRA, www.debra-study.info), a nationally representative household survey. EC cannabis use for mood-changing effects was assessed in 504 current EC users (aged ≥ 18 years) of the total sample (N = 32,678). Ever use was defined by: (1) occasional or regular use, or (2) experimental consumption. Associations with socio-demographic consumer characteristics and tobacco smoking were analyzed using multivariable regression analyses. Results: Amongst current EC users, 7.2% had ever vaporized cannabis: 2.3% (95%CI = 1.2-3.9) reported occasional or regular use (1) and 4.8% (95%CI = 3.2-7.1) reported experimental use (2). Age was associated with ever EC cannabis use: highest prevalence rates were found among 18-24-year-olds: 6.5% (95%CI = 2.3-13.1) (1) and 8.0% (95%CI = 3.7-15.8) (2), respectively. The majority (90.2%) of ever EC cannabis users were current tobacco smokers. Conclusions: One in 14 current EC users in Germany has ever vaporized cannabis for mood-changing reasons, and almost all EC cannabis consumers also smoke tobacco. Highest usage rates can be observed among young adults. Hence, trends of EC drug misuse need to be monitored consequently, particularly in young people.

Vilches JR, Taylor MB, Filbey FM. A Multiple Correspondence Analysis of Patterns of CBD Use in Hemp and Marijuana Users. Front Psychiatry 2020; 11:624012. [PMID: 33519562 PMCID: PMC7840961 DOI: 10.3389/fpsyt.2020.624012] [Citation(s) in RCA: 5]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/30/2020] [Accepted: 12/14/2020] [Indexed: 12/17/2022] Open
Abstract
Background: With the passing of the 2018 Agriculture Improvement Act that legalized hemp-derived products, i.e., cannabidiol (CBD), the use of CBD has increased exponentially. To date, the few studies that have characterized individuals who use CBD suggest that co-use of CBD and tetrahydrocannabinol (THC)-dominant cannabis, i.e., marijuana, is highly prevalent. It is, therefore, important to investigate the relationship between CBD use and marijuana use to understand the antecedents and consequences of co-use of these two cannabis products. Methods: We conducted an online survey using structured questionnaires to determine differences in CBD users with (CBD+MJ) and without co-morbid marijuana use. Group comparisons were carried out using chi-square tests and ANOVA. Multiple correspondence analysis (MCA) with bootstrap ratio testing was performed to examine the relationship between the categorical data. Results: We received 182 survey responses from current CBD users. CBD+MJ had more types of CBD administration (F = 17.07, p < 0.001) and longer lifetime duration of CBD use (χ2 = 12.85, p < 0.05). Results from the MCA yielded two statistically significant dimensions that accounted for 77% of the total variance. Dimension 1 (representing 57% of the variance) associated CBD+MJ with indication of CBD use for medical ailments, use of CBD for more than once a day for longer than 2 years, applying CBD topically or consuming it via vaping or edibles, being female, and, having lower educational attainment. Dimension 2 (representing 20% of the variance) separated the groups primarily on smoking-related behaviors where CBD+MJ was associated with smoking CBD and nicotine. Conclusions: Identifying the factors that influence use of CBD and marijuana can inform future studies on the risks and benefits associated with each substance as well as the impacts of policies related to cannabis-based products.

Trivers KF, Gentzke AS, Phillips E, Tynan M, Marynak KL, Schauer GL. Substances used in electronic vapor products among adults in the United States, 2017. Addict Behav Rep 2019; 10:100222. [PMID: 31828201 PMCID: PMC6888746 DOI: 10.1016/j.abrep.2019.100222] [Citation(s) in RCA: 15]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/12/2019] [Revised: 09/20/2019] [Accepted: 09/20/2019] [Indexed: 12/31/2022] Open
Abstract
Electronic vapor products are used by adults for a variety of substances. Nicotine was the most commonly reported substance used in electronic vapor products. Many adults also use these devices for flavors and marijuana. Adults younger than 30 years and females were more likely to report flavor use.
Introduction Electronic vapor products (EVPs), including e-cigarettes, can be used to aerosolize many substances. Examination of substances used in EVPs by US adults has been limited; we assessed past-year use of EVPs to deliver various substances. Methods Data came from the 2017 SummerStyles Survey, a web-based survey of US adults (N = 4107). Ever EVP users were asked if they had used nicotine, marijuana, flavors or “something else” in an EVP during the past year. Weighted estimates for any, exclusive, and combined EVP substance use were calculated among ever (n = 586) and current (past 30-day; n = 121) EVP users. Results Past-year use of nicotine, flavors, and marijuana in EVPs was 30.7%, 23.6%, and 12.5% among ever EVP users, respectively; and 72.3%, 54.6%, and 17.8% among current EVP users. Among ever EVP users, the most commonly used substances were nicotine only (29.6%), nicotine plus flavors (27.2%), flavors only (16.4%), and marijuana only (14.9%). Among current EVP users, the most common substances used were nicotine plus flavors (39.1%), nicotine only (29.6%), and flavors only (11.2%). Among ever users, males and 18–29 year olds were more likely to report use of flavors than females and respondents ≥30 years. Conclusions Approximately 7 in 10 current EVP users reported nicotine use, about 1 in 2 used flavors, and nearly 1 in 6 used marijuana. These findings suggest that EVPs are used to consume a variety of substances and could guide efforts to address tobacco and non-tobacco substance use.

Mercurio A, Aston ER, Claborn KR, Waye K, Rosen RK. Marijuana as a Substitute for Prescription Medications: A Qualitative Study. Subst Use Misuse 2019; 54:1894-1902. [PMID: 31179810 PMCID: PMC6625880 DOI: 10.1080/10826084.2019.1618336] [Citation(s) in RCA: 18] [Impact Index Per Article: 3.6]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 01/26/2023]
Abstract
Background: Over the past few decades in the United States, marijuana for medical purposes has become increasingly prevalent. Initial qualitative and epidemiological research suggests that marijuana may be a promising substitute for traditional pharmacotherapies. Objectives: This qualitative study examined perceptions relating to (1) using medical marijuana in comparison to other prescription medications and (2) user perception of policy issues that limit adoption of medical marijuana use. Methods: Qualitative interviews were conducted with Rhode Island medical marijuana card holders (N = 25). The interviews followed a semi-structured agenda designed to collect information from participants about their reasons for, and perceptions of, medical marijuana use. All interviews were audio recorded, transcribed verbatim, and de-identified. Qualitative codes were developed from the agenda and emergent topics raised by the participants. Results: Three themes emerged related to medical marijuana use, including (1) comparison of medical marijuana to other medications (i.e., better and/or fewer side effects than prescription medications, improves quality of life), (2) substitution of marijuana for other medications (i.e., in addition to or instead of), and (3) how perception of medical marijuana policy impacts use (i.e., stigma, travel, cost, and lack of instruction regarding use). Conclusions: Several factors prevent pervasive medical marijuana use, including stigma, cost, and the inability for healthcare providers to relay instructions regarding dosing, strain, and method of use. Findings suggest that medical patients consider marijuana to be a viable alternative for opioids and other prescription medications, though certain policy barriers inhibit widespread implementation of marijuana as a treatment option.
